In the preceding paper [1], we studied in detail the grounds of the distributive charts in the spaces spanned by cycles and developed a simple synthesis procedure. However the procedure can not be applied to the synthesis of semimodular charts. One of the difficulties with semimodular charts was that we failed to find a theorem which corresponds to Lemma 2.8 in [1]. The present paper undertakes the synthesis procedure for the semimodular state charts. Although a synthesis procedure for semimodular charts was first given in [2], it is indirect and impractical. Thus the purpose of this paper is to give a direct and clear one for semimodular charts. To help the explanation about the sequence of steps of the procedures, simple state charts are synthesized with figurative expressions for some intermediate steps.
